Job description

  • You must have dedicated CT Modality experience to be considered for this position
  • Provide on-site and phone support to FSE and TSS to address installation, application and technical issues.
  • Provide second-level support in escalated issues. Escalate issues to National Technical Support (NTS) per protocol.
  • Participate in Technical Operations modality conference calls and ensure that region FSEs are fully informed of the latest information and developments.
  • Regularly review all Field Service Memos and other technical documentation posted on the Service Information System (SIS) and ensure region FSEs fully understand their content.
  • Participate in the installation of new products within the region.
  • Support the Beta testing of Field Maintenance Instructions occurring within the zone. Monitor the status and facilitate the completion of all services within the region.
  • Work with NTS to ensure all Veterans Administration sites are ready for inspection; support each inspection on-site.
  • Monitor sites experiencing abnormally high numbers of service calls and conduct site audits, as appropriate, to uncover underlying causes.
  • Conduct on-the-job-training within the region to help develop a team of senior region modality FSEs to assist other FSEs when the region specialist is unavailable. Mentor FSEs who have failed or struggled in a class at the Training Academy.
  • Define FSE training needs and recommend actions to zone management. Provide supplemental technical training and local seminars related to installation, troubleshooting skills and new product introductions.
  • Review and evaluate systems in terms of image quality and system performance. Implement and monitor field service enhancements and programs (re: InnerVision).
  • Gather input for defining product issues and document concerns. Consult with zone management team in escalating product issues to NTS.
  • Provide timely and accurate technical documentation on assigned projects. Distribute appropriate technical information to the front line staff. Network with other zones to share technical information.
  • Support zone service marketing efforts.
  • Works directly with eligible external customers in remotely troubleshooting, and when possible, resolving product problems via phone.
  • Collaborates with the Clinical Support Team at the CMSU Solutions Center to analyze and identify solutions to customer issues using product knowledge and remote tools.
  • Escalates technical issues and inquiries, as needed.
  • Provides remote technical support and recommendations on products within a specific imaging modality to internal customers using product knowledge and field experience.
  • Monitors and analyzes service alerts from customer scanners and resolves or escalates as appropriate
  • Contributes to and generates knowledge articles per P&P.
